* On the morning of November 18th, Politburo member and Standing Deputy Prime Minister Nguyen Hoa Binh, Head of the Central Steering Committee for National Target Programs for the 2021-2025 period, chaired a meeting with ministries and agencies on the progress of drafting the Report proposing investment policies for national target programs on building new rural areas, sustainable poverty reduction, and socio-economic development in ethnic minority and mountainous areas for the 2026-2035 period. Deputy Prime Minister Tran Hong Ha also attended.

Emphasizing that the integration of programs is not intended to reduce preferential policies but rather to increase them in various aspects, the Deputy Prime Minister highly appreciated the efforts of the Ministry of Agriculture and Environment in preparing the program proposal as directed by the Government; and requested the Ministry to supplement, refine, and develop the proposal focusing on key issues and priorities, while also addressing difficulties and bottlenecks.

* On the afternoon of November 18th, during a meeting with Dr. Marcin Czepelak, Secretary-General of the Permanent Court of Arbitration (PCA), who was on a working visit to Vietnam, Politburo member and Standing Deputy Prime Minister Nguyen Hoa Binh congratulated the PCA on establishing a representative office in Vietnam and expressed his hope that this representative office would increasingly assert its position in Vietnam and Asia.

The Deputy Prime Minister stated that the PCA's intention to bring many cases to Vietnam for trial demonstrates the PCA's position and prestige, as well as Vietnam's contributions to the PCA. The Vietnamese government always supports activities aimed at upholding justice. The PCA Secretary-General affirmed that the PCA is ready to support and cooperate with Vietnam within the framework of the International Finance Corporation.

* On the morning of November 18th, at the Government Headquarters, Deputy Prime Minister Tran Hong Ha chaired the 22nd meeting of the National Steering Committee on combating illegal, unreported, and unregulated (IUU) fishing, connecting online with 21 coastal provinces and cities.

The Deputy Prime Minister emphasized the leading role of the Ministry of Agriculture and Environment in state management of fisheries, and requested relevant agencies to directly supervise and inspect to overcome delays in the implementation of assigned tasks. Regarding the national fisheries database, the Deputy Prime Minister directed the urgent completion of the project to build a synchronized, unified, interconnected, and shared national fisheries data system before December 31st.

The Deputy Prime Minister requested the Government Inspectorate to review all legal instruments and sanctions for handling administrative violations related to IUU fishing, select a number of localities for inspection and guidance to resolve 100% of outstanding cases... In the long term, localities need to assess the livelihood transformation for fishermen and build sustainable fisheries policies.
